解析身份证信息:
- ID=input("输入你的身份证号:")
- shengfen = ID[0:2]
- year = ID[6:10]
- month = ID[10:12]
- day = ID[12:14]
- sex=ID[-2]
- print('你的省份信息为:'+shengfen)
- print('出生日期为:'+year+'年'+day+'月'+day+'日')
- if (int(sex) % 2) == 0:
- print('性别为: 女性')
- else:
- print('性别为: 男性')

2. 英文词频统计预处理
下载一首英文的歌词或文章或小说.
将所有大写转换为小写
将所有其他做分隔符 (,.?!) 替换为空格
分隔出一个一个的单词
并统计单词出现的次数.
- import operator
- text='''It was a cold winter day in 1919. A small boy was walking along the street in London.
- His name was Tom. He was very hungry.
- He wanted to buy some bread, but he had no money.
- What could he do? When he was very young, he wanted to be a great man in the world of films.
- So he worked to sing and dance well.
- Thirty years later, the boy became one of the famous people in the world.'''text1=text.replace('.',' ').replace('?',' ').replace(',',' ').lower().split();
- dic = {}
- for Word in text1:
- if Word not in dic:
- dic[Word] = 1;
- else:
- dic[Word] = dic[Word] + 1;
- swd = sorted(dic.items(), key=operator.itemgetter(1), reverse=True)
- print(swd)
